This was the dramatic scene above Pendle Hill as a giant hail cloud formed.
The image, captured by Lancashire Telegraph photographer John Mills on Monday, resulted from strong winds and freezing temperatures.
A Met Office spokesman said: “Hail forms in strong thunderstorms clouds, particularly those with intense updrafts, which will often be near mountains.”
